I wanted to purchase a large tool box to store small parts in and saw this crazy auction for this:
– Durham brown 112 hole bolt bin approximate size 63.25″ tall x 35.25″ wide x 12″ deep
–Actually a 72 and a 40 screwed together.
– Durham grey 72 hole bolt bin approximate size 42″ tall x 35.25″ wide x 12″ deep
– Durham brown 40 hole bolt bin approximate size 21″ tall x 35.25″ wide x 12″ deep
– Lyon brown 56 hole bolt bin approximate size 37.5″ tall x 35.25″ wide x 9″ deep
– Durham green 40 hole bolt bin approximate size 22.25″ tall x 33.75″ wide x 8.5″ deep

– Durham 18 drawer cabinet with drawers

– 2 x Durham brown 4 drawer cabinets with 8 drawers
– 3 x Durham grey 4 drawer cabinets with drawers (12 storage drawers)
– 7 x Durham storage drawers without cabinets
